PHYS 550 - Introduction To Quantum Mechanics

Description: | Brief historical survey of the development of quantum mechanics; waves in classical physics, wavepackets, uncertainty principle wave functions, operators, expectation values of dynamical observables: Schrodinger equation with application to one-dimensional problems, the hydrogen atom; electron spin, periodic table; selected topics in perturbation theory, scattering theory and compounding angular momenta. Designed for students needing quantum mechanics background for specialty courses such as PHYS 545, 556, and 564. Not available for students with credit in PHYS 360 or 460. |
